Abstract
The present application provides a display apparatus including: a display panel having a plurality of pixels disposed in a matrix; a first polarizer; a second polarizer; a surface emitting light source; a third polarizer; and a polarization control element whose orientation of a transmission axis changes according to a control signal. A control section outputs a control signal that controls orientation of the transmission axis of the polarization control element so that a polarization axis of transmission light of the polarization control element is oriented in a direction crossing the transmission axis of the first polarizer in a part corresponding to a pixel position of black display and is oriented in a direction parallel to the transmission axis of the first polarizer in a part corresponding to a pixel position of white display.
